93 scholars finish tech-voc courses
Thursday, March 15, 2012

These scholars were graduates of the course - plumbing national certificate (NC) II.
The graduates are the pioneering batch of scholars who availed themselves of the partnership between the Foundation and Tesda. Of the 93, a total of 82 scholars passed the national assessment exam for their respective courses and are now considered duly certified.
The following are the courses that were taken up by the scholars: plumbing national certificate (NC) II, refrigeration & air conditioning servicing (RAC) NC I, automotive servicing NC I, building wiring installation NC II, and computer hardware servicing NC II.
“We recognize the need to equip these students with these skills for them to become more competent in the future,” said Sonny Carpio, executive vice-president/managing trustee of Aboitiz Foundation.
The project was established to help the increasing number of students who are unable to proceed to college due to financial difficulties and help them build a brighter future after graduating from Tesda.
